about us
We build enterprise platforms — powered by deep-tech innovation
wHO ARE WE
Shadowcast is a specialist engineering studio with a multi-disciplinary team of:
Platform & systems engineers
AI & machine learning specialists
Spatial computing technologists
Simulation & digital twin experts
Computer vision engineers
Real-time 3D artists & game-engine developers
Visual artists, animators & creative technologists
Our strength is the combination of enterprise-level platform engineering and deep-tech specialism — enabling us to build systems that are powerful, scalable, immersive and future-ready.
wHAT WE BUILD
Enterprise-Scale Platforms
Large, complex systems with multi-tenant architecture, real-time data pipelines, deep integrations and long-term operational reliability.
This is the core of our business and the foundation for long-term client partnerships.
Advanced Deep-Tech Systems
AI automation engines, reasoning agents, spatial computing tools, computer-vision measurement pipelines, behaviour simulations, virtual production workflows and digital twins.
High-Tech Startup POCs & Scale-Up Platforms
We build investor-ready demos and prototypes for deep-tech startups — often solving the most challenging components first (vision, simulation, agent logic, spatial interaction). When they scale, we become the team that delivers the full production platform.
how we work
Platform-First Engineering
Architecture, workflows, data, security, performance and reliability come first — ensuring long-term stability and scalability.
Deep-Tech Where It Creates the Most Value
AI, simulation, spatial computing and computer vision are layered into platforms where they significantly enhance capability, efficiency or user experience.
End-to-End Delivery
From concept → POC → MVP → full production platform, we stay with clients across their entire journey.
Future-Proof by Design
We build systems that evolve as your organisation grows — without costly rebuilds or disruptive rewrites.
wHY ORGANISATIONS CHOOSE US
We deliver the big platforms and the advanced technology.
Most studios are either platform builders or deep-tech specialists, Shadowcast is both.
We specialise in complexity.
Large datasets, real-time workloads, immersive environments, multi-agent logic, automation engines, CV measurement and simulation — this is our comfort zone.
We combine engineering and creativity.
Our platforms are technically robust and visually compelling, integrating real-time 3D, XR and generative content where needed.
We form long-term partnerships.
Startups grow with us. Enterprises modernise with us. Creative teams collaborate with us.
We turn ambitious ideas into real systems.
What begins as a prototype becomes a fully deployed platform used daily by operators, customers and teams.
OUR tECHNOLOGY
We work across a unified deep-tech and platform engineering stack, including:
AI & ML — Transformers, LoRA, embeddings, automation pipelines
Spatial Computing — Unity, Unreal, ARKit, ARCore, Quest, Vision Pro
Simulation — Behaviour modelling, multi-agent systems, real-time environments.
Computer Vision — Detection, tracking, geometry, measurement & reconstruction.
Cloud & Infrastructure — AWS, GCP, GPU orchestration, microservices.
3D & Real-Time — WebGL, USD, Blender, Houdini, real-time rendering pipelines.
We don’t just use technology — we build the systems that push it further.
OUR pHILOSOPHY
Build the platform. Layer in deep-tech. Deliver it for the real world.
Technology should work beautifully, scale effortlessly and feel intuitive. It should solve real problems, unlock new capabilities and enable teams to do their best work. At Shadowcast, we engineer the systems behind the next generation of applications — intelligent, immersive and designed for impact. This is why clients stay with us as they grow.
Leadership
Craig Wiltshire — Founder & Chief Architect
Craig is a deep-tech architect specialising in large-scale platforms, AI systems engineering and advanced spatial and simulation technologies. He combines architectural leadership with hands-on engineering across agentic AI systems, computer vision, real-time 3D, cloud-native infrastructure and complex backend services. His technical development includes online MIT coursework in Computer Science, Engineering and Mathematics for Computer Science, alongside advanced practitioner training in agentic AI systems, LLM fine-tuning, federated learning, edge computing, computer vision, Python engineering and industrial control systems. This broad, cross-disciplinary training strengthens his ability to design and implement high-performance, intelligent systems. A former Royal Marines Commando and IPC Europa Cup downhill skier, Craig brings a high performance, real-world mindset to engineering — designing systems that are resilient, scalable and capable of operating under real-world constraints. At Shadowcast, Craig leads platform architecture and the integration of AI, simulation, spatial computing and computer vision across enterprise platforms and deep-tech products, guiding organisations from early prototypes to full production systems.
Let’s Build What’s Next
Whether you’re a startup building breakthrough tech or an enterprise modernising operations, we build the platforms and systems that power the future.
Contact us
If you have a project in mind then we would love to hear from you: